Jeff Wadlow, writer-director of Kick-Ass 2, talks about how he’s working on the script of a possible X-Force movie for Fox. Who knows, maybe he’ll end up directing it too!

When Mark [Millar] got the job with Fox I said “The first movie you guys should make is an X-Force movie and here’s how you should do it.” And that got him excited, and that got the studio excited and that’s the movie I’m writing.

A couple of Bat-related rumors come from ThinkMcflyThink. First one is, we might have a new contender for the Batman role in the Batman/Superman movie, and it’s none other than Jeffrey Dean Morgan, whom Zack Snyder already directed in Watchmen. The other rumor is that we might get a Gotham PD TV series.

[It] would essentially take place between the aftermath of The Dark Knight and before the return of Batman in The Dark Knight Rises. The story would involve the pressure on Gotham’s finest to take control of the city during Batman’s hiatus from crime fighting.

Yeah, so the reason Bruce Willis is not on The Expendables 3? He wanted to get paid $1 million a day. Sly et al were “lol no”. I do love this delicious shade coming from “the insider”:

I think [Willis] was pretty surprised he was replaced in 72 hours by Harrison Ford — a better actor, a much nicer person and a more interesting direction for the film.
